한판
Appearance
Korean
[edit]Etymology 1
[edit]Compound of 한 (han, “one”) + 판 (pan, “round, match”).

Etymology 2
[edit]Probably from 한 (han-, “precise, accurate”) + (복)판 ((bok)pan, “the middle”).

Noun
[edit]한판 • (hanpan)
- (North Korea) the very middle, the precise center
